Role Overview:

We have a fantastic opportunity for a part qualified Engineer to join our Civil & Structural Engineering team in our Plymouth office. Join our Industrial Placement Scheme where youll gain exposure to complex project work receiving support from our Chartered Engineers.

We are looking for students from an Engineering background with a passion for the building design and the desire to work alongside and learn in a highly collaborative multidisciplinary team focused on sustainability technical excellence and shaping construction for the UK and overseas.

Responsibilities of the role:

  • Project work at concept and scheme design modelling detailed design specification and drawing
  • Preparation of reports providing advice and guidance to clients and project teams
  • Undertaking STEM engagement activities
  • Liaising with internal and external stakeholders developing relationships and people skills
  • Managing your workload to meet project deadlines
  • Arranging and attending meetings taking minutes and distributing actions

Youll be set up for success if you have:

  • Partway completed a relevant degree BEng (Hons) or BSc (Hons)
  • Humanity selfmotivation and enthusiasm
  • Excellent communication and written skills
  • A desire to learn from industry experts
